The Night Sky

North Star Light Trails

Every now and again, I dabble around the edges of astrophotography – light trails around the North Star, or capturing the clusters of the Milky Way itself. For either type of photography, it really demands a very dark night sky, uncluttered by light pollution. This means my opportunities are generally limited to trips out of the big city. It is a very demanding genre, requiring much skill and discipline to ensure the camera is set up properly before leaving it to run for up to an hour. Clearly there is much to be learned and practiced, but I do hope to continue my education in all things related to the night sky.
